Multilayered generation and processing of computer instructions

US12530198B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-12530198-B2
Application numberUS-202318496527-A
CountryUS
Kind codeB2
Filing dateOct 27, 2023
Priority dateJul 1, 2021
Publication dateJan 20, 2026
Grant dateJan 20, 2026

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Systems, devices, computer-implemented methods, and tangible non-transitory computer readable media for performing multilayered generation and processing of computer instructions are provided. For example, a computing device may receive a request with instructions in a first computer language, parse the instructions in the first computer language, analyze the instructions in the first computer language in view of information describing structure of a first application, generate instructions in a second computer language different from the first computer language where the instructions in the second computer language are generated based on the instructions in the first computer language and the information describing structure of the first application, obtain a result from a second application where the result comprises information based on the instructions in the second computing language, and provide the result in response to the request comprising the instructions in the first computer language.

First claim

Opening claim text (preview).

What is claimed is: 1 . A computer system that implements an organizational management platform, the computer system comprising: one or more processors; one or more databases that collectively store organizational data associated with an organization, wherein the organizational data comprises an object graph data structure comprising a plurality of data objects, and wherein the organizational data specifies relationships between employee data objects and other data objects of the plurality of data objects; and one or more non-transitory computer-readable media that collectively store instructions that, when executed by the one or more processors, cause the computer system to perform operations, the operations comprising: receiving a user-defined query expression that comprises one or more operators that return one or more of the data objects that have a specified relationship with a specified employee data object within the organizational data; and automatically evaluating the user-defined query expression by parsing computer language instructions and generating instructions in a different computing language with one or more data joins identified based on an application that comprises the organizational data to modify at least one data object in the object graph data structure that is associated with the application, and to identify one or more of the other data objects that have the specified relationship with the specified employee data object, wherein the one or more of the other data objects comprise one of any of one or more timecard objects, one or more benefit policy objects, one or more pay instance objects, and one or more job candidate objects associated with the specified employee in the object graph data. 2 . The computer system of claim 1 , wherein the data objects comprise nodes in the object graph data structure and wherein edges between the nodes correspond to defined relationships between the data objects. 3 . The computer system of claim 1 , wherein evaluating the user-defined query expression using the organizational data comprises traversing the object graph data structure from the specified employee to the one or more of the other data objects. 4 . The computer system of claim 1 , wherein the one or more of the other data objects comprise one or more devices objects associated with the specified employee in the object graph data. 5 . The computer system of claim 1 , wherein the one or more of the other data objects comprise one or more document objects associated with the specified employee in the object graph data. 6 . The computer system of claim 1 , wherein the one or more of the other data objects comprise the one or more timecard objects associated with the specified employee in the object graph data. 7 . The computer system of claim 1 , wherein the one or more of the other data objects comprise the one or more benefit policy objects associated with the specified employee in the object graph data. 8 . The computer system of claim 1 , wherein the one or more of the other data objects comprise the one or more pay instance objects associated with the specified employee in the object graph data. 9 . The computer system of claim 1 , wherein the one or more of the other data objects comprise the one or more job candidate objects associated with the specified employee in the object graph data. 10 . A computer-implemented method, comprising: accessing, by a computing system comprising one or more computing devices, one or more databases that collectively store organizational data associated with an organization, wherein the organizational data comprises an object graph data structure comprising a plurality of data objects, and wherein the organizational data specifies relationships between employee data objects and other data objects of the plurality of data objects; receiving, by the computing system, a user-defined query expression comprising one or more operators associated with a computing language that return one or more of the data objects that have a specified relationship with a specified employee data object within the organizational data; incorporating, by the computing system, the user-defined query expression into an automated data processing routine; and automatically evaluating, by the computing system, the user-defined query expression by parsing computer language instructions and generating instructions in a different computing language with one or more data joins identified based on an application that comprises the organizational data to modify at least one data object in the object graph data structure, and to identify one or more of the other data objects that have the specified relationship with the specified employee data object, wherein the one or more of the other data objects comprise one of any of one or more timecard objects, one or more benefit policy objects, one or more pay instance objects, one or more job candidate objects, and one or more other types of additional data objects associated with the specified employee in the object graph data. 11 . The computer-implemented method of claim 10 , wherein the data objects comprise nodes in the object graph data structure and wherein edges between the nodes correspond to defined relationships between the data objects. 12 . The computer-implemented method of claim 10 , wherein evaluating the user-defined query expression using the organizational data comprises traversing the object graph data structure from the specified employee to the one or more of the other data objects. 13 . The computer-implemented method of claim 10 , wherein the one or more of the other data objects comprise one or more devices objects associated with the specified employee in the object graph data. 14 . The computer-implemented method of claim 10 , wherein the one or more of the other data objects comprise one or more document objects associated with the specified employee in the object graph data. 15 . The computer-implemented method of claim 10 , wherein the one or more of the other data objects comprise the one or more timecard objects associated with the specified employee in the object graph data. 16 . The computer-implemented method of claim 10 , wherein the one or more of the other data objects comprise the one or more benefit policy objects associated with the specified employee in the object graph data. 17 . The computer-implemented method of claim 10 , wherein the one or more of the other data objects comprise the one or more pay instance objects associated with the specified employee in the object graph data. 18 . The computer-implemented method of claim 10 , wherein the one or more of the other data objects comprise the one or more job candidate objects associated with the specified employee in the object graph data. 19 . A computer-implemented method, the method comprising: maintaining, by a computing system comprising one or more computing devices, organizational data associated with an organization, wherein the organizational data comprises an object graph data structure comprising a plurality of data objects, and wherein the organizational data specifies relationships between employee data objects and other data objects of the plurality of data objects; and receiving, by the computing system, a user-defined query expression that comprises one or more operators that return one or more of the other data objects that have a specified organizational relationship with a specified employee data object within the organizational d

Assignees

Inventors

Classifications

  • Object persistence · CPC title

  • Temporal data queries · CPC title

  • Source to source · CPC title

  • Graphs; Linked lists (G06F16/9027 takes precedence) · CPC title

  • Creation or modification of classes or clusters ·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US12530198B2 cover?
Systems, devices, computer-implemented methods, and tangible non-transitory computer readable media for performing multilayered generation and processing of computer instructions are provided. For example, a computing device may receive a request with instructions in a first computer language, parse the instructions in the first computer language, analyze the instructions in the first computer …
Who is the assignee on this patent?
People Center Inc
What technology area does this patent fall under?
Primary CPC classification G06F9/3017.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Jan 20 2026 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).